Combining Downhole Axial and Surface Oscillation Tools, What Are the Consequences on Tool Face Control Performance?

Abstract: When drilling in sliding mode, axial oscillation tools (AOT) and surface oscillation tools (SOT) are two possible solutions that are used in the industry to overcome the friction forces, especially in unconventional well trajectories with a long lateral section. The AOT is assembled in the drillstring and run in hole such that it is generally placed in the middle of the lateral section.
